Job Purpose and Impact

The Construction Safety Lead is responsible for leading and executing construction safety programs to ensure ZERO Harm across projects. This role oversees safety performance metrics, manages third‑party Construction Safety Specialists, conducts construction safety audits, and drives continuous improvement through data‑driven insights and strong leadership in ZERO Harm initiatives.

Key Accountabilities
  • Track, analyze, and report construction safety metrics using Enablon, Avetta, and Power

    BI.
  • Manage and coordinate third‑party Construction Safety Specialists to ensure consistent safety standards across projects.
  • Support Construction Team management group with planning and coordination of safety resources and project safety planning.
  • Conduct Construction Safety Audits to verify compliance with company policies, regulatory requirements, and industry best practices.
  • Lead and promote ZERO Harm initiatives, focusing on SIF Elimination
  • Identify trends, risks, and opportunities for improvement through data analysis and audit findings.
  • Support continuous improvement of construction safety programs and processes.
  • Other duties as assigned

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in a related field or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um of six years of related work experience.
  • Experience in construction safety management or a related safety role.
  • Ability to travel up to 75%.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Working knowledge of safety management systems such as Enablon and Avetta.
  • Experience using Power

    BI or similar tools to analyze and present safety data.
  • Proven ability to lead safety initiatives and influence cross‑functional and third‑party teams.
  • Strong audit, risk assessment, and problem‑sol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and leadership capabilities.
